Real Madrid’s Karim Benzema left out of France squad after sex tape blackmail charge

French stars Karim Benzema, who is at the centre of a sex tape blackmail scandal, and Mathieu Valbuena, the victim of the extortion attempt, were excluded from the France squad named on Thursday for two internationals this month.

They were left out hours after a French judge formally charged Real Madrid striker Benzema with complicity to blackmail Valbuena.

France play Germany on November 13 in Paris and England on November 17 at Wembley in friendlies as they prepare to host the European Championships next year.

French coach Didier Deschamps refused to comment on the legal case but said Benzema was injured and not available to play for Real Madrid or France anyway.

He added that Lyon playmaker Valbuena "isn't in the best psychological condition because of this affair so I decided to let him rest during these games."

"The best is to let justice do its work and take the decisions it has to," Deschamps said. The coach refused to answer other questions on the case.
